Prof. Giovanni Maglia is a Full Professor of Chemical Biology at the University of Groningen, affiliated with the Groningen Biomolecular Sciences and Biotechnology Institute (GBB). He also serves as Founder and Scientific Director of Portal Biotech, a spin-off from the University of Groningen. His academic career includes roles as Associate Professor (2014–2020) and Assistant Professor (2010–2014) at the University of Leuven and University of Leuven/Chemistry Department, respectively.
Education:
- PhD in Chemistry, University of Birmingham (2000–2004)
- Postdoctoral Fellow at University of Oxford under Prof. H. Bayley (2006–2010)
- Postdoctoral Fellow at University of Leuven under Prof. Y. Engelborghs (2005)
Research: The Maglia Lab focuses on the chemistry and biophysics of nanopores, engineering them for applications in nanobiotechnology and single-molecule biophysics. Key areas include single-molecule enzymology, protein sequencing, and nanopore-based sensing. Collaborations with the Tych Lab further advance nanopore design and neuromorphic computing.
Notable Achievements:
- Recipient of ERC Proof of Concept Grant (2024) for improving heart failure patient monitoring
- Lead developer of nanopore technologies for protein sequencing and biomolecular analysis
- Co-founder of Portal Biotech, advancing nanopore-based diagnostic tools
Labs/Teams: The Maglia Lab and Tych Lab collaborate on projects such as portable nanopore analyzers and synthetic cell membrane engineering. Research is anchored at the GBB Institute in Groningen.
